1. Roof Tents
While conventional outdoors tents need you to thoroughly establish each item of your sleep system once you reach camp, rooftop styles allow you to take shelter from the back of your car while still taking pleasure in a sight and security from ground wetness. They're likewise much more budget-friendly than trailers or camper vans and can be utilized to sleep anywhere outdoor camping is enabled-- including assigned camping areas, national parks, and personal land.

There are many different brands of roof covering outdoors tents to pick from, with some concentrating on hardshell designs, others dealing with the overlanding crowd, and some offering both hard and soft shell alternatives. Lots of designs come with an awning and some offer attachments like LED strip lights or telescoping ladders.

The majority of roof camping tents can be established in a matter of minutes and are easy to load down once more for transportation. 4. Freestanding Outdoors tents
Choosing a camping tent is greater than just choosing a sanctuary that fits your budget. Aspects like the problems you plan to camp in will certainly establish which type of camping tent is best for you.

As an example, a freestanding camping tent does not require stakes to remain upright, which is a big deal if you wind up camping on rough ground that makes it hard to drive in tent stakes. These sorts of tents likewise have a tendency to be larger than non-freestanding outdoors tents.
